We ran the full TPC-H benchmark with the scale factor 1,000 dataset using the duckdb-tpch project. Our setup included two server platforms: an x86 baseline (Intel Xeon 6) and NVIDIA Vera. We also compared two DuckDB versions: the latest stable version (v1.5.5) and the upcoming release's alpha version (v2.0.0-alpha), with the latter shipping several optimizations that make complex workloads such as TPC-H faster.

Platforms

x86 Baseline: Intel Xeon 6

We ran the benchmark on a server with an Intel Xeon 6 CPU.

  • CPU: Intel Xeon 6 CPU, 96 cores with hyper-threading
  • Memory: 768 GB
  • Disk: 1 NVMe SSD with 3 TB+ storage, formatted to ext4
  • Operating system: Ubuntu 26.04

DuckDB flags:

SET threads = 96;
SET block_allocator_memory = '500G';
SET allocator_background_threads = true;

NVIDIA Vera

We conducted the benchmark on a dual-socket system but restricted DuckDB to a single socket.

  • CPU: NVIDIA Vera CPU, 88 cores with Spatial Multithreading
  • Memory: 768 GB
  • Disk: 1 NVMe SSD with 3 TB+ storage, formatted to ext4
  • Operating system: Ubuntu 26.04

DuckDB flags:

SET threads = 88;
SET block_allocator_memory = '500G';
SET allocator_background_threads = true;

DuckDB Versions

We ran DuckDB using the Python client and benchmarked two DuckDB versions:

  • DuckDB v1.5.5
  • DuckDB v2.0.0-alpha (Python package: 1.6.0.dev379)

Benchmark Methodology

We performed an initial warmup run and discarded its result, then conducted three runs and took the median value of the QphH@SF composite scores.

Benchmark Results

  Setup 1 Setup 2 Setup 3 Setup 4
CPU Intel Intel Vera Vera
DuckDB 1.5.5 2.0.0-alpha 1.5.5 2.0.0-alpha
Run 1 1,643,610.87 2,120,588.82 2,488,209.48 3,073,292.99
Run 2 1,700,471.78 2,022,795.01 2,389,726.36 3,131,306.27
Run 3 1,673,422.48 2,109,782.19 2,482,589.73 3,052,102.87
Median score 1,673,422.48 2,109,782.19 2,482,589.73 3,073,292.99

The results show two key findings. First, the Vera platform has a 46–48% performance advantage on TPC-H SF1,000 over the x86 baseline (Xeon 6). Second, DuckDB v2.0.0-alpha shows a 24–26% improvement over DuckDB v1.5.5 on both CPUs – and this is something all users will benefit from once DuckDB v2.0.0 is out.
